Essential Skills for DIY Home Automation
To excel in creating DIY home automation solutions, you'll need a blend of technical and practical skills. Here are some of the key areas to focus on:
1. Programming Proficiency: Python is the backbone of many home automation projects. Familiarize yourself with Python's syntax, libraries, and frameworks. Understanding object-oriented programming and data structures will also be beneficial.
2. Hardware Knowledge: Arduino boards are the go-to for many DIY projects. Learn about different Arduino models, their pins, and how to interface them with sensors and actuators. Understanding electronics basics, such as voltage, current, and resistance, is crucial.
3. Integrated Development Environment (IDE): Get comfortable with Arduino IDE and Python IDEs like PyCharm or VSCode. These tools are essential for writing, testing, and debugging your code.
4. Networking Skills: Many home automation projects involve wireless communication. Familiarize yourself with protocols like Wi-Fi, Bluetooth, and Zigbee. Understanding how to secure these networks is also important.
5. Problem-Solving and Troubleshooting: DIY projects often come with unexpected challenges. Developing strong problem-solving skills and the ability to troubleshoot hardware and software issues will save you a lot of time and frustration.
Best Practices for Successful DIY Home Automation Projects
Creating a successful DIY home automation project involves more than just technical skills. Here are some best practices to keep in mind:
1. Start Small: Begin with simple projects like automating a light switch or a temperature sensor. As you gain confidence, gradually take on more complex projects.
2. Document Everything: Keep detailed notes of your code, wiring diagrams, and any modifications you make. This will be invaluable if you need to troubleshoot or replicate your project.
3. Use Version Control: Tools like Git can help you manage different versions of your code. This is especially useful if you're collaborating with others or if you need to revert to a previous version.
4. Prioritize Security: Home automation systems often connect to the internet, making them potential targets for hackers. Ensure you implement strong security measures, such as encrypting data and using secure passwords.
5. Stay Updated: Technology is constantly evolving. Keep yourself updated with the latest trends, tools, and best practices in Python and Arduino development.
Hands-On Projects to Build Your Skills
Practical experience is key to mastering DIY home automation. Here are some hands-on projects to help you build your skills:
1. Smart Lighting System: Create a smart lighting system that can be controlled via a mobile app or voice commands. This project will help you understand how to interface LED lights with Arduino and control them using Python.
2. Automated Irrigation System: Build an automated irrigation system that waters your plants based on soil moisture levels. This project involves sensors, actuators, and real-time data processing.
3. Home Security System: Develop a home security system that includes motion sensors, cameras, and alerts. This project will give you a deep understanding of networking and security protocols.
4. Smart Thermostat: Create a smart thermostat that adjusts the temperature based on occupancy and time of day. This project will help you understand temperature sensors and control mechanisms.
